Bankroll Management Strategies
The biggest hidden trick successful players use is disciplined bankroll management. Most casual gamers fail because they ignore this fundamental principle. You should never wager more than two to three percent of your total bankroll on a single session. This approach keeps you in the game longer and increases your chances of hitting winning streaks.
Professional players maintain separate accounts for different game types. This segregation prevents emotional decisions and allows precise tracking of profitability.
